GMP clinical manufacturing plays a crucial role in the development of pharmaceutical products Good Manufacturing Practice (GMP) guidelines ensure that drugs are consistently produced and controlled to meet quality standards suitable for their intended use This article will discuss the significance of GMP clinical manufacturing in the pharmaceutical industry and its impact on the drug development process.
GMP regulations are designed to safeguard the health of consumers by ensuring the quality, safety, and efficacy of pharmaceutical products Compliance with these regulations is mandatory for pharmaceutical companies when manufacturing drugs for clinical trials and commercial distribution GMP guidelines cover various aspects of drug production, including facility design, equipment maintenance, personnel training, and recordkeeping.
One of the primary objectives of GMP clinical manufacturing is to minimize the risk of contamination or errors that could compromise the safety and efficacy of pharmaceutical products By establishing strict quality control measures and operating procedures, GMP guidelines help pharmaceutical companies maintain consistency in their manufacturing processes and ensure that their products meet the specified quality standards.
In addition to ensuring product quality, GMP clinical manufacturing also plays a crucial role in regulatory compliance Before a new drug can be tested in clinical trials or approved for commercial distribution, it must undergo rigorous testing to demonstrate its safety and efficacy GMP guidelines provide a framework for conducting these tests in a controlled and standardized environment, ensuring that the results are reliable and can be used to support regulatory submissions.

GMP guidelines also help companies identify areas for improvement and implement corrective actions to prevent quality issues from recurring.
Another key benefit of GMP clinical manufacturing is enhanced product traceability GMP regulations require pharmaceutical companies to maintain detailed records of their manufacturing processes, including the origin of raw materials, production steps, and quality control tests This information is crucial for tracking and investigating any issues that may arise during the manufacturing process, ensuring that products can be traced back to their source and any deviations can be addressed promptly.
